Randy Orton, a seasoned WWE veteran, found himself in a heated feud with John Cena leading up to Backlash 2025. The tension between the two wrestlers escalated when Cena targeted Orton’s family, sparking a personal vendetta between the two rivals.
At the highly anticipated Backlash 2025 event, John Cena emerged victorious against Randy Orton, retaining the Undisputed WWE Championship after a grueling match that lasted nearly 30 minutes. Despite his confidence in securing the title, Orton was left disappointed with the outcome.
In a behind-the-scenes video released by WWE, Randy Orton can be seen expressing his displeasure over Cena’s comments about his family. Orton, with a fiery intensity in his eyes, issued a warning to Cena, stating, “If this wasn’t personal, it sure as hell is personal right now. Talking about my family like that, my old man, my grandpa. I wholeheartedly, honestly think, without a shadow of a doubt, tomorrow in St. Louis, Cena is fu*ked.”
Reflecting on his loss in the Undisputed WWE title match, Orton opened up about his disappointment in the same BTS vlog from Backlash 2025. Despite his aspirations of leaving with the championship, Orton revealed the emotional toll of falling short in front of his family and loved ones present at the event.
